The User Manual says pin 6 and pin 29 are Vdd connections, powering the ADC, IO pins, the processor, etc. They are not internally connected together and both must be powered.

My question is, is it pin 6 or pin 29 powering the USB PLL for the LPC11Uxx part?

(I am just trying to learn whether pin 6 or pin 29 will more likely have more RF noise, if you are wondering why I am asking this question. That's all.)
